Cora Jade Shuts Down Troll Over Alleged Wardrobe Malfunction

What Happened?

Cora Jade, a WWE NXT star, recently shared a video of herself running on a tennis court. However, a fan noticed a brief glimpse of the video that appeared blurred, and speculated that Jade was topless.

Jade’s Response

Jade quickly responded to the fan, clarifying that the video showed her wearing a swimsuit top. She expressed frustration at the inappropriate comments and accused the fan of grasping at straws.

Recovery Journey

Jade has been sidelined since January due to a torn ACL, but she has been updating her fans on her recovery progress. She recently completed her first Biodex test, an important milestone in her rehabilitation.

CM Punk’s ‘Daughter’

Jade formed a close bond with CM Punk during his brief return to WWE in 2023. Punk referred to Jade and Roxanne Perez as his “daughters” and supported Jade during her recovery.

Alleged Topless Clip

Despite Punk’s support, Jade faced further online controversy when a grainy clip of her running with dogs was circulated. Some fans falsely speculated that she was topless, prompting Jade to dismiss the claims and emphasize that she was wearing a swimsuit.

Money in the Bank 2024 Match Card

In other WWE news, the match card for the upcoming Money in the Bank 2024 pay-per-view has been announced. The event will feature several exciting matches, including:

– Cody Rhodes, Randy Orton, and Kevin Owens vs. The Bloodline (Solo Sikoa, Tama Tanga, Tonga Loa, and Jacob Fatu)

– Damian Priest (c) vs. Seth Rollins for the World Heavyweight Championship

– Iyo Sky vs. Chelsea Green vs. Lyra Valkyria vs. Tiffany Stratton vs. Naomi vs. Zoey Stark in the Women’s Money in the Bank ladder match

– Jey Uso vs. Carmelo Hayes vs. Andrade vs. Chad Gable vs. LA Knight vs. Drew McIntyre in the Men’s Money in the Bank ladder match

– Sami Zayn (c) vs. Bron Breakker for the Intercontinental Championship
